About Marcus Ang
Marcus Ang is a scholar working on Management Information Systems, Ophthalmology and Management Science and Operations Research, having authored 18 papers that have together received 310 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Glaucoma and retinal disorders (5 papers), Advanced Queuing Theory Analysis (4 papers) and Supply Chain and Inventory Management (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Ophthalmology (76 citations), Pharmaceutical Science (47 citations) and Management Information Systems (65 citations). Marcus Ang has collaborated with scholars based in Singapore, China and United States. Frequent co-authors include Yun Fong Lim, Melvyn Sim, Subbu S. Venkatraman, Natarajan, Jie Sun, Qiang Yao, Hanqin Zhang, Li Luo, Mabel C. Chou and Jingui Xie. Their work appears in journals such as Management Science, European Journal of Operational Research and Operations Research.
